SERBIA, Horgo�: Migrants gather and at a razor-wire fence in Horgo�, Serbia on September 17, 2015. Recently the migrants have clashed with police forcing the police to use tear gas and water cannons to hold the refugees at bay. The migrants demanded that the razor-wire fence be opened, which would allow them to continue their journey though Europe. PAKISTAN, Peshawar: Transgender individuals from 14 different Pakistani districts represented their communities in a  multi-stakeholder  consultation on September 17, 2015 in Peshawar.   The consultation addressed the transgender community's need for protection and equal rights. Issues such as displacement, sex work, harassment were addressed. The consultation put forward recommendations to the government on how to increase the legal protections of transgender individuals. BURKINA FASO, Ouagadougou : Residents rally along a street in Ouagadougou on September 17, 2015, after Burkina Faso's presidential guard declared a coup, a day after seizing the interim president and senior government members, as the country geared up for its first elections since the overthrow of longtime leader Blaise Compaore.
